            Summary
          
          Course deals with theory of dependability of unrestored and restored objects. In
the meaning of ISO standards dependability is understood as availability and
factors affecting it at most are reliability, maintainability and maintenance
provision. Also this course is about improving dependability, corrective
maintenance policy problems, preventive maintenance and methods of its
optimization. Also it’s focused on implementing of complex productive
maintenance and diagnostic methods problems including use of artificial
intelligence (AI) elements at its applications.

            Subject syllabus:
          
          1. Introduction to the problems dependability technical objects, determination notion quality and dependability.
2. Indexes dependability objects, system access to  increases in dependability, classification failures.
3. Statistically and probability expression indices of dependability.
4. Indices dependability unrenewed objects.
5. Indices dependability recnewed objects.
6. Theoretic statutes probability distribution in  locution indicator dependability.
7. Maintainability technical objects.
8. Organization planning and assurance of maintainance.
9. Costs on life cycle, economics aspects at optimalization maintainance.
10. Dependability evaluation systems, examination dependability of elements and systems.
11. Dependability model of systems.
12. Increasing dependability systems, hardware redundance – backup.
13. Problems software dependability.
14. Diagnostics at increasing dependability, basic method diagnostics.
15. Dependability and organization maintainance.
